There's a whole system for petitioning the President. Basically, you can start a petition yourself; it's then up to you to get the first 150 signatures before the White House allows visitors to the site to see it in their listings. If a petition gets 5,000 or more signatures (they claim), it then goes before the White House staff for review.

You have to sign up for an account at whitehouse.gov to sign, of course, but they let you opt-out of Re-elect Obama spam (they claim).
